    <description>The Supreme Court upheld the Bombay High Court&#039;s decision that Rules 16 and 43 of the Stock Exchange Rules were valid and fair. It was ruled that the membership of the Stock Exchange is not an asset of the share broker and upon default, the membership vests in the Exchange. There was no conflict found between the Stock Exchange Rules and the Insolvency Act. The distribution of proceeds from the sale of a defaulting member&#039;s membership card was deemed just and fair, prioritizing payments to the Exchange and creditors. The appeal was dismissed, affirming the decisions of the lower courts.</description>
